Abstract(in English) Intelligent Transport System has recently attracted attention as a next safety driving support system. The dielectric lens antenna is one of the devices of collision avoidance radar. In this paper, the radiation characteristics of a dielectric lens antenna are calculated by using the three dimensional ray trace method. The primary radiator is a conical horn antenna. The dielectric lens is made of ABS resin whose permittivity is 1.625,and its shape is arbitrarily. Calculated frequency is 76.5GHz.
